AUER - ORA

Region: Trentino-Alto Adige
Province : Bolzano

Auer.jpg

Official blazon

  • (de) Unter blauem Schildhaupt, darin zwei gekreuzte goldene Schlüssel, von Silber und Rot geteiltes Feld, darin ein nach links steigender Löwe in verwechselten Farben.
  • (it) Troncato d'argento e di rosso al leone rampante rivoltato dell'uno nell'altro. Il tutto sotto un colmo d'azzurro caricato di due chiavi d'oro poste in decusse.

Origin/meaning

The arms were granted on April 11, 1969.

The arms show in the upper part the crossed keys of St. Peter, the parish saint. The lower part shows the arms of the family Khuen. The Khuen family first got possessions in Auer in 1397 and were one of the most important families until 1690. The family was later raised to Imperial Counts.
